Just noticed weekly export sales on beans. China bought what was it 1.3 mmt I think. Did they price those purchases? We don’t know because we don’t get to see the contracts but did anyone notice that November soy futures only went up I mean went down 3 cents for the period June 5-11.

Now look at this past week where nov bean prices only went up 5 cents. Let’s see next Thursday how many beans China bought in that time period. Look at the last 10 days of November soybean futures in the chart. Someone or something is sitting on the market. Not that it would normally go up this time of year but that looks fishy. The longer it stays down the more potential fuel for the fire.
